ChetMagongalo wrote: What kind of verb are you looking for? I found the Context great for ambient and longer decays but I really didn't like it for anything else. I found it to be kind of gated and sterile but :idk:
Actually just snagged a Context in bst :lol:

I play a lot of stoner doom stuff (poorly) but eventually I always sneak black metal style riffs and chords into songs. I'm just looking for a haunting, ambient reverb to kind of drown my guitars while retaining definition, especially in barre chords when I'm strumming somewhat fast. I couldn't seem to get my RRR to do this. Everything got too jumbled and I just couldn't find the sweet spot on the mix knob. I have it up for sale but if it doesn't sell I'm fine with it, using it on my small board currently and it is still an amazing verb. I think the extra flexibility of the Context will help. Think it'll work for what I want?
